Officers 4 All Departments, Commissions, and Committees 1 Consultants Consultants shall be included in the list of designated employees and shall disclose pursuant to the broadest disclosure category in the Code subject to the following limitation: The City Manager may determine in writing that a particular consultant, although a "designated position,' is hired to perform a range of duties that is limited in scope and thus is not required to fully comply with the disclosure requirements in this section. Such written determination shall include a description of the consultant's duties based upon that description, and a statement of the extent of disclosure requirement. The City Manager's determination is a public record and shall be retained for public inspection in the same manner and location as this Conflict of Interest Code. APPENDIX OF DISCLOSURE CATEGORIES Persons in the following categories must disclose as follows: Category Disclosure 1. All investments and business positions in business entities, sources of income, loans and gifts, and all interests in real property within two miles of the boundaries of the City of Bakersfield, and all interests in real property within two miles of any land owned or used by the City of Bakersfield. 2. Investments and business positions in business entities and sources of income which provide services, supplies, materials, machinery or equipment of the type utilized by the City of Bakersfield, and all loans and gifts from such entities. 3. All investments and business positions in business entities, sources of income, loans and gifts, and all interests in real property within two miles of the redevelopment project area. 4.
